Tin roof repair services involve inspecting, maintaining, and restoring metal roofing systems to ensure they remain durable and functional. These services typically include fixing leaks, replacing damaged panels, sealing seams, and addressing corrosion or rust issues. Proper repairs help extend the lifespan of a tin roof and prevent minor problems from developing into more costly repairs or replacements. Homeowners experiencing issues with their metal roofs can rely on local contractors to assess the condition of the roof and recommend the appropriate repairs needed to keep the roof in good condition.

Many problems can arise with tin roofs that require professional repair services. Common issues include leaks caused by damaged or loose panels, rust or corrosion weakening the metal, and seam failures where panels join together. Additionally, severe weather events such as hail, strong winds, or heavy snowfall can cause dents, cracks, or other damage. Addressing these problems promptly helps prevent water intrusion, structural damage, and further deterioration of the roof. Local contractors are equipped to diagnose the root cause of issues and provide effective repairs tailored to the specific type of damage.

The overview below groups typical Tin Roof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Most minor roof repairs, such as fixing leaks or replacing damaged shingles, typically fall within the $250-$600 range. These jobs are common and usually straightforward for local contractors to handle efficiently.

Moderate Repairs - More extensive repairs, like patching large areas or fixing structural issues, generally cost between $600 and $2,000. Many routine projects land in this middle range, with fewer reaching the higher end.

Full Roof Replacement - Replacing an entire roof can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more, depending on the size and materials used. Larger, more complex projects tend to push costs into the higher tiers.

Complex or Custom Projects - Specialty work, such as installing premium materials or handling unusual roof designs, can exceed $20,000. These projects are less common and typically involve higher costs due to their complexity.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
